Mission High School Overview

About This School

Mission High School is a public high in Las Vegas, Nevada, serving 18 students in grades Grade 6-12. Academic results show that students demonstrate proficiency with 50% in ELA and 50% in math. The school maintains a small learning environment with a 3:1 student-teacher ratio and a staff of 6 teachers. The average teacher salary is $78,591, while the school provides access to counseling services at a ratio of 18 students per counselor. The student body is composed of 39% male and 61% female students. In terms of ethnicity, the population is 56% White and 44% Hispanic.
